Crypto Lobby Unites to Push for Brian Quintenz as CFTC Chair
Seven major cryptocurrency lobbying groups have formed a rare coalition to urge President Trump to advance Brian Quintenz's stalled nomination as Chairman of the Commodity Futures Trading Commission. The groups argue his experience is vital as the CFTC prepares for expanded oversight of digital assets.
The Senate Agriculture Committee has twice cancelled votes on Quintenz's nomination, prompting speculation about behind-the-scenes opposition. The Winklevoss twins are among those reportedly opposing the nomination, though their reasons remain unclear.
This coordinated push represents a significant show of force from an industry often divided on regulatory matters. The unified front includes influential organizations like the crypto Council for Innovation and Blockchain Association, signaling the high stakes for crypto markets.
